A Cuyahoga Ohio Lease of Commercial Building with Lessor to Construct Building is a legally binding document that outlines the terms and conditions of a lease agreement between a lessor and a lessee in Cuyahoga County, Ohio. This type of lease agreement is unique as it includes provisions for the lessor to construct a building on the leased premises specifically tailored to meet the lessee's needs. This lease agreement is commonly used by businesses and individuals who require a specific type of commercial building or facility but do not have the resources or expertise to construct it themselves. It provides an opportunity for lessees to have a custom-built space without the inherent costs and efforts associated with managing a construction project. The Cuyahoga Ohio Lease of Commercial Building with Lessor to Construct Building typically includes the following key provisions: 1. Parties involved: The lease agreement identifies the lessor, who owns or controls the premises, and the lessee, who will be occupying the leased space. 2. Lease term: It specifies the duration of the lease agreement, including the start and end date. It may also outline provisions for renewals or extensions. 3. Description of premises: The lease agreement provides a detailed description of the premises, including the location, size, and any specific requirements for the construction of the building. 4. Construction specifications: This section outlines the lessee's requirements and expectations regarding the construction of the building. It may include details such as the type of materials, layout, zoning requirements, and any specific industry standards. 5. Construction timeline: The agreement may establish a reasonable timeframe for the construction process to be completed. It may also include provisions for penalties or incentives based on the timeliness of the construction. 6. Rent and payment terms: It outlines the financial obligations of the lessee, including the base rent, any additional fees, and the schedule of payments. This section may also include provisions for rent escalation or adjustments during the lease term. 7. Maintenance and repairs: The agreement typically delineates the responsibilities of both parties regarding maintenance and repairs. It may specify which party is responsible for certain types of repairs, routine maintenance, or compliance with local building codes and regulations. 8. Insurance and liability: The lease agreement often requires both parties to maintain appropriate insurance coverage and outlines the allocation of risk and liability between them. 9. Termination and default: This section establishes the rights and remedies of both the lessor and lessee in case of default or breach of the lease agreement. It may include provisions for a cure period, termination fees, or dispute resolution mechanisms. Different types of Cuyahoga Ohio Lease of Commercial Building with Lessor to Construct Building may vary based on the specific nature of the lessee's business or industry. For instance, a lease agreement for a retail space with a lessor to construct a shopping center will have different provisions compared to a lease agreement for an office building or a warehouse facility.
